    Guildford

In the heart of the Surrey Hills with direct access to London, Guildford is a hub for innovation.

With a reputation as a creative and tech powerhouse, reinforced by the development of 5G, Games sector and digital health tech, not only is Guildford a region of economic importance, but it’s also one of the most desirable places to live in the UK.

Whether you are an individual, business owner, entrepreneur or wealth creator with interests both within the region and internationally, our multidisciplinary team offer a broad range of skills and are here to support you and help you reach your goals. Our presence in Guildford dates back to 1945 and we combine our years of local knowledge, with the depth of legal expertise provided through our global offices and networks. 

We can provide you with legal services across all business disciplines of commercial dispute resolution, real estate disputes and employment, through to personal advice around family, personal tax planning, private wealth disputes and private property.  

This unique part of the world is home to organisations such as Surrey Hills Enterprises, Guildford.Games, Guildford Shakespeare and Business South all of which we are delighted to work closely with and, where possible, support through our own Community Foundation.
